Anastasia Potapova defeated Sorana Cirstea 6-4 6-7 7-5 in the Budapest quarter-final on clay. The upset overturned the form book — Sorana Cirstea came in ranked #19, leading the head-to-head 2–0, defending last year's round of 32. Anastasia Potapova claimed a first win over Sorana Cirstea in three meetings, narrowing the head-to-head to 2–1.
